The production function. Choose the right answer and explain how you arrive at this answer.
For:
Q
=
f(L)
=
800L + 200 L2 - 0.02 L3
Where:
Q
=
Output in units
L
=
Labor units employed
a. Begins to exhibit diminishing returns to labor at L = 5000.
b. Enters stage 2 at L = 3333.
c. Enters stage 3 at L = 5000.
d. None of the above statements are accurate.

Explanation / Answer
as dQ/dL = 800+400L-0.06L^2
=> dQ/dL =0 is not at L= 3333 or 5000
so ans is none of the above are accurate
